Bewakoof, one of India’s fastest-growing D2C lifestyle and fashion brands, has announced the opening of its latest retail store in Jaipur — the Pink City renowned for its vibrant culture, artistic heritage and trend-savvy consumers. The announcement was shared on LinkedIn by Prabhkiran Singh, Founder and CEO of Bewakoof, underscoring the brand’s enthusiasm for engaging with Jaipur’s dynamic fashion community.
Founded in 2012 by IIT graduates Prabhkiran Singh and Siddharth Munot, Bewakoof has emerged as a youthful, digitally native apparel and lifestyle label known for its relatable, expressive designs and strong engagement with millennial and Gen-Z audiences. The brand operates through a direct-to-consumer model, creating high-quality casual wear, accessories and statement pieces at accessible prices, and has sold millions of products across India.

From its early beginnings as a social media-driven fashion startup, Bewakoof has expanded its offerings beyond T-shirts to include hoodies, denim, joggers, and a wide range of expressive apparel and accessories that resonate with today’s youth culture. The company focuses on creativity, affordability and community connection, with strong sales performance and retail presence across multiple cities.
“We’ve opened our store inside Jaipur’s walls, but truly between us — Jaipur is the lucky one,” Singh noted in his LinkedIn post, celebrating the city’s deep appreciation for design, individuality and aesthetic expression. Jaipur’s fashion-forward audience, he added, makes the city more than a market — a living mood board for brands that value creativity and cultural relevance.

The Jaipur store marks another milestone in Bewakoof’s expanding retail footprint, reinforcing the brand’s commitment to marrying its digital-first success with offline consumer experiences that reflect local tastes and lifestyle preferences.
